The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s requiring Confluence sk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 26 February 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
26 Feb 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 94 102 122
Rank change year-on-year +8 +20 -25
Contract jobs citing Confluence 1,127 777 834
As % of all contract jobs in the UK 2.72% 2.53% 1.90%
As % of the Application Platforms category 27.81% 21.88% 19.78%
Number of daily rates quoted 826 495 556
10th Percentile £331 £313 £369
25th Percentile £402 £410 £450
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£500 £500 £545
Median % change year-on-year - -8.26% -0.91%
75th Percentile £613 £613 £630
90th Percentile £726 £704 £700
UK excluding London median daily rate £475 £510 £550
% change year-on-year -6.86% -7.27% +1.85%
